vasae 发表于 2006-4-28 20:26

[求助]请教happy教授:

请问以下程序中怎样将r的值赋到u(r),v(r),w(r)中<BR>h=20;<BR>a=100/h;<BR>for i=0:h:100<BR>      for j=0:h:100<BR>                for k=0:h:100<BR>                     r=i/h+j/h*(a+1)+k/h*(a+1)^2;<BR>                     u(r)=i<BR>                     v(r)=j<BR>                     w(r)=k<BR>                end<BR>      end<BR>end<BR><BR>运行时系统提示:??? Subscript indices must either be real positive integers or logicals.<BR><BR>请高手指点,谢谢!<BR><BR>

happy 发表于 2006-4-30 18:40

回复:(vasae)[求助]请教happy教授:

<P>r=i/h+j/h*(a+1)+k/h*(a+1)^2;<br>有可能出现零,零是不能作为下标的</P>
[此贴子已经被作者于2006-4-30 18:42:01编辑过]
页: [1]
查看完整版本: [求助]请教happy教授: